Halo Safe Sleep Practices:

•    Place baby to sleep on his or her back at naptime and at night time.
•    Use a crib that meets current safety standards with a firm mattress that fits snuggly and is covered with only a tight-fitting crib sheet.
•    Remove all soft bedding and toys from your baby’s sleep area (this includes loose blankets, bumpers and positioners). The American Academy of   Pediatrics suggests using a wearable blanket instead of loose blankets to keep your baby warm.
•    Offer a pacifier when putting baby to sleep. If breastfeeding, introduce pacifier after one month or after breastfeeding has been established.
•    Breastfeed, if possible, but when finished, put your baby back to sleep in his or her separate safe sleep area alongside your bed.
•    Never put your baby to sleep on any soft surface (adult beds, sofas, chairs, water beds, quilts, sheep skins etc.)
•    Never dress your baby too warmly for sleep; keep room temperature 68-72 degrees Fahrenheit.
•    Never allow anyone to smoke around your baby or take your baby into a room or car where someone has recently smoked.

This is a rare and unusual site.  Hawks hard ever are seen together like this.  They are loner birds and normally you might see a mating pair if you're lucky.  But these hawks are gathering together and getting ready to migrate south as the weather cools.  The fields and sky has been taken over by them the past couple days.

The Body Wracked



Several years ago I was diagnosed with Fibromyalgia, along with my degenerative disk disease, and rheumatoid arthritis. All three of which cause pain of some sort or another. This isn't something I normally talk about, and I don't really know why I'm talking about it now to you, except it's been on my mind lately.

For those of you who don't know what Fibromyalgia is, it has symptoms of aches in the muscles and connective tissues accompanied by fatigue. It's been the fatigue that has been rearing it's ugly head lately and I find myself needing to lay down 3 -4 times a day. About 2 hours after I first get up in the morning, I'm just so exhausted that I have to go lay down again.

I've managed to keep most of the aches and pains at bay for awhile now by taking care of myself, taking lots of vitamins, stretching, exercising, and taking ibuprofen and tylenol when I needed it. But now that the weather is changing, temperatures cooling and biometric pressure quick changes bring on a bit more aches. But it's the fatigue that is worrying me now.
